What is This Thing in the Trunk That Keeps Making Noise!?
Often when my car is on (either accessory mode or engine on, doesn't matter), there is a mechanical "whirring" sound coming from a component in the trunk. The sound cycles on and off every few seconds. It seems to be coming from a black component (pictured) located in the driver's side truck area near the amplifier.
Can anyone tell me what this thing is, and if the sound is normal? Thank you!
PS: The car (2010 550) is somewhat new to me. Only 19K miles, so I'm hoping it's normal, but who knows.
